U.S. Air Force Master Sgt. Tiffany Le, Defense POW/MIA Accounting Agency (DPAA) linguist uses a pinpointer metal detector to find a metal hit during an investigation mission in the Socialist Republic of Vietnam, Nov. 1, 2024. DPAA linguists serve as cultural experts and translators while conducting investigation and recovery efforts, in addition to performing the duties expected of every team member. There are approximately 1,576 personnel missing from the Vietnam War. (U.S. Air Force photo by Staff Sgt. Cole Yardley)
